Fawkes is a compact and good-looking short-coated sable boy who is coming up to 6 years old. He is lively and friendly; he loves to interact with people but sometimes gets a little over-excited and will jump up. Fawkes knows all his basic commands and walks reasonably well on the lead with good engagement.
His play style is boisterous and not suitable for a home with children or regularly visiting small ones.
Fawkes has never shown any aggression, but he does grumble about being dried or brushed so new owners need to have the experience manage this. He has never lived with another dog and has had limited interaction outside. He has played well with females but has got into a couple of minor scraps with other young males so is generally kept away.
He has been taught to move aside and sit to allow dogs to pass.
Fawkes is fully house-trained; he does not chew anything other than toys and is fine to be left for short periods. He loves going in the car and settles well until he recognises a favoured destination.
Fawkes is being rehomed because of a change in family circumstances which mean his owners feel that he is not getting the amount of mental stimulation and exercise that he needs to thrive.
